Marguerite Van-Brocklin 1904 - 2002

Marguerite Van-Brocklin of Clinton, Oneida County, NY was born on August 18, 1904, and died at age 97 years old on January 4, 2002.

In 1904, in the year that Marguerite Van-Brocklin was born, the United States acquired the Panama Canal Zone. Now an unincorporated territory of the U.S., the Canal Zone had been previously held by the French, who were constructing a canal. The U.S. took over the construction of the Panama Canal and it was finally finished in 1914, when it was opened to commercial shipping. The United States held the Canal Zone until 1979.

In 1918, Marguerite was only 14 years old when following European countries, Daylight Saving Time went into effect in the United States in March. It was an effort to conserve fuel needed to produce electric power. This was a war effort and proved unpopular so in most areas of the United States, Daylight Saving Time ended after World War I. It returned during World War II.
